What does an insurance risk engineer do?

An Insurance Risk Engineer assesses potential risks associated with a business or property to help insurers make informed underwriting decisions. They analyze safety protocols, operational procedures, and structural conditions to identify hazards and recommend risk mitigation strategies. Their goal is to minimize potential losses for both the insurer and the policyholder by implementing effective preventive measures. Risk engineers often conduct site inspections, review compliance with industry regulations, and provide detailed reports to underwriters. This role requires a strong understanding of engineering principles, risk assessment methodologies, and industry-specific safety standards.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an insurance risk engineer?

To thrive as an Insurance Risk Engineer, you need a solid background in engineering or a related technical field, strong analytical abilities, and in-depth knowledge of risk assessment methodologies. Familiarity with risk modeling software, industry safety codes, and certifications such as CFPS (Certified Fire Protection Specialist) or ARM (Associate in Risk Management) is highly valued. Exceptional communication, problem-solving skills, and attention to detail are key soft skills for effectively interacting with clients and translating complex technical findings. These competencies ensure accurate risk evaluations, support underwriters, and help mitigate losses, ultimately protecting both insurers and their clients.

About the Role

We are seeking a highly motivated data scientist to join the Data Science Accelerator Program (DSAP) that provides broad learning opportunities across the Data Science organization within the LexisNexis Insurance Division. Successful candidates will holistically learn our business during this two-year program while rotating through a series of Analytical product development related assignments and projects. The role will be Hybrid located at our headquarters in Alpharetta, GA and may include some travel.

Responsibilities:

  • Assist with assembling, cleaning, and organizing large datasets to prepare them for analysis.
  • Support team members in merging and parsing data to uncover trends and patterns.
  • Learn to apply statistical and machine learning techniques under the guidance of senior data scientists.
  • Help document model code, track results, and contribute to validating predictive models.
  • Assist in creating attributes and rules from raw data to support analytic projects.
  • Contribute to data visualization efforts to communicate findings.
  • Participate in preparing responses to client inquiries regarding data, score calculations, or analytic outputs.
  • Document work clearly and practice presenting results in a team setting.

Requirements:

  • Hold a bachelor's in data science/analytics, Computer Science, Mathematics, or other degrees in fields like Engineering, Economics, and Business.
  • Coursework or project experience in Python or R; familiarity with SQL is a plus
  • Interest in data analysis, predictive modeling, and machine learning.
  • Exposure to data visualization tools (e.g., Tableau, Power BI, Matplotlib, Seaborn) is desirable.
  • Strong problem-solving skills with a willingness to learn and adapt.
  • Ability to communicate ideas clearly and work collaboratively with others
